Software Engineer 1 - CRM

Intuit is a market-leading financial management platform for small and mid-market businesses, seeking to transform QuickBooks into an all-in-one business management platform. The Software Engineer 1 - CRM role is designed for individuals at the start of their career, focusing on developing web applications and contributing to the QuickBooks Customer Hub, enhancing customer relationship management capabilities.
